Dee Brown's "Failures & Success" review

Ya know it goes down when Dee Brown comes to towns. He did it again with another wonderful work, that will have you going wild and mild. He is strongly message orientated, and will have you deeply thinking about your priorities. After listening to thing you will be woke to the real struggle of anybodies hustle. You will have no issues when you hear Track 09- "Problems".

This is the second mixtape I heard from Dee. He is very talented, and has the work ethic to get it cracking. It makes me real proud to see an artist keep going, no matter what obstacal may occur. When you come from real roots, you are for sure to thrive through any challenge. This Mississippi grinder knows how to keep it going with Track 10- "Ridin".

What's real special is Dee is not scared to give it to yall straight. He is open about being broke. Not many of us have alot of money, so everybody on the planet can relate. It's way to many fake rappers bragging about a bunch of money they really don't have. What's wrong with keeping it real, and telling people the truth. He did his thang and spit about his change with Track 01- "Nickles and Dimes".

I really expect big things from Dee Brown in the future. I do have to say he should think about changing his name somewhat, because there are alot of Dee Browns out here. It might be difficult for someone to Google his name. It's all good and I always put the like to the mixtape at the bottem.
